Listening in stereo
When you select STEREO, you will hear the source 
through just the front left and right speakers (and 
possibly your subwoofer depending on your speaker 
settings). Multichannel sources are downmixed to 
stereo.
While listening to a source, press 
, then 
press STEREO for stereo playback.
Press repeatedly to switch between:
• STEREO – The audio is heard with your sound 
settings and you can still use the audio options.
• F.S.SURR FOCUS – See Using Front Stage Surround 
Advance below for more on this.
• F.S.SURR WIDE – See Using Front Stage Surround 
Advance below for more on this.

Using Front Stage Surround Advance
The Front Stage Surround Advance function allows you to 
create natural surround sound effects using just the front 
speakers and the subwoofer.
While listening to a source, press 
, then 
press STEREO to select Front Stage Surround Advance 
modes.
• STEREO – See Listening in stereo above for more on 
this.
• F.S.SURR FOCUS – Use to provide a rich surround 
sound effect directed to the center of where the front 
left and right speakers sound projection area 
converges.
• F.S.SURR WIDE – Use to provide a surround sound 
effect to a wider area than FOCUS mode.
Using Stream Direct
Use the Stream Direct modes when you want to hear the 
truest possible reproduction of a source. All unnecessary 
signal processing is bypassed, and you’re left with the 
pure analog or digital sound source. Processing differs 
depending on the input signal and whether or not 
surround back speakers are connected. For details, see 
Auto Surround, ALC and Stream Direct with different input 
signal formats
 on page 103.
While listening to a source, press 
, then 
press AUTO/ALC/DIRECT (AUTO SURR/ALC/STREAM 
DIRECT) to select the mode you want.
Check the digital format indicators in the front panel 
display to see how the source is being processed.
• AUTO SURROUND – See Auto playback on page 52.
• ALC – Listening in Auto level control mode (page 52).
• DIRECT – Plays back sound from the source with the 
least modification next to PURE DIRECT. With 
DIRECT, the only modifications added to PURE 
DIRECT
 playback are calibration of the sound field by 
the MCACC system and the Phase Control effect.
• PURE DIRECT – Plays back unmodified sound from 
source with only minimal digital treatment. No sound 
is output from the Speaker B in this mode.
